Transaction a8423859285c9a2a3abf8b02dd7f2d25e0eb76e386587671c079c130d92329fd
1 Input
1 Output
-
a8423859285c9a2a3abf8b02dd7f2d25e0eb76e386587671c079c130d92329fd:0
- value
- 44662948
- script pubkey
- OP_0 OP_PUSHBYTES_20 d5a885b32aba4f028e1cd8a913045fff7fdfea3e
- address
- bc1q6k5gtve2hf8s9rsumz53xpzllalal637dknffz